Renewable Energy Innovation
Several young innovators are leading projects in solar, wind, and biomass energy. They are optimizing energy production systems, improving efficiency, and lowering costs to make renewable energy accessible for urban and rural communities. Innovative projects include distributed solar microgrids for remote regions, AI-powered wind turbine monitoring systems, and biomass energy solutions that reduce reliance on fossil fuels. These young leaders demonstrate how technology and sustainability can be combined to accelerate the transition to low-carbon energy sources.

Sustainable Urban Development
Urban sustainability initiatives are a key focus area for young green tech leaders. Projects include smart building energy management systems, urban air quality monitoring networks, and green transportation solutions such as electric mobility platforms. By integrating digital tools, sensors, and AI-driven analytics, these innovators improve energy efficiency, reduce emissions, and enhance urban livability. Cities like Shanghai, Beijing, and Shenzhen serve as testbeds for pilot projects that can be scaled nationally.

Waste Management and Circular Economy
Another critical area for young leaders is waste reduction and circular economy solutions. Initiatives include waste-to-energy technologies, recycling platforms, and innovative product design to minimize environmental impact. These projects not only reduce landfill usage but also generate economic value from otherwise discarded materials. Startups led by under-30 innovators are leveraging blockchain for supply chain transparency, ensuring that recycled materials are properly tracked and reused effectively.

Agriculture and Environmental Sustainability
Green tech entrepreneurs under 30 are also transforming agriculture through sustainable practices. Precision agriculture projects use sensors, AI analytics, and automated irrigation systems to optimize water usage, reduce chemical inputs, and increase crop yields. Young innovators are developing bio-based fertilizers, pest management systems, and soil health monitoring tools. These efforts enhance food security, reduce environmental impact, and create replicable models for sustainable farming across China.

Challenges and Strategic Approaches
While their impact is significant, young green tech leaders face challenges including:

  • Funding Limitations: Early-stage projects often require substantial capital investment to scale.
  • Technology Adoption: Encouraging industries, municipalities, and consumers to adopt new green solutions can be slow.
  • Regulatory Hurdles: Navigating environmental regulations and compliance standards requires expertise and resources.
  • Scalability: Expanding pilot projects to larger regional or national implementations demands strategic planning and operational capacity.

Innovators overcome these challenges through strategic partnerships, leveraging digital tools for monitoring, and aligning projects with national sustainability priorities.
